Atlanta (ATL) to Pandie Pandie Airport (PDE)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Hartsfield - Jackson Atlanta International Airport (ATL) in Atlanta, United States to Pandie Pandie Airport (PDE) in Pandie Pandie Airport, Australia is 15,740 kilometers (9,780 miles / 8,499 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 20h, flying west at a heading of 269°.

This is an ultra-long-haul route, one of the longest in aviation. It requires wide-body aircraft with extended range capability such as the Airbus A350-900ULR or Boeing 777-200LR. Passengers should prepare for an extended flight with multiple meal services.

This is an international route connecting United States with Australia. It is an intercontinental flight between North America and Oceania.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 07:36 in Atlanta, it's 23:06 in Pandie Pandie Airport. With a 15.5-hour time difference, travelers should plan for significant jet lag. It typically takes one day per hour of time difference to fully adjust.

There is a significant elevation difference of 1,026 feet between the two airports. Pandie Pandie Airport sits lower than Hartsfield - Jackson Atlanta International Airport.

The return flight from Pandie Pandie Airport (PDE) to Atlanta (ATL) follows a heading of 68° (east northeast).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
